Alternative RNA splicing is the regulated splicing of exons and introns to produce different mature mRNAs from a single pre-mRNA. Unlike in constitutive splicing where a single gene produces a single type of mRNA, alternative splicing allows an organism to produce multiple proteins from a single gene and plays an important role in protein diversity.

Splicing is the process by which eukaryotic RNA is edited before its translation into protein. The RNA strand transcribed from eukaryotic DNA is called the primary transcript. The primary transcripts that become mRNAs are called precursor messenger RNAs (pre-mRNAs). Eukaryotic pre-mRNA contains alternating sequences of exons and introns. Epigenetics is the study of inherited changes in a cell's phenotype without changing the DNA sequences. It provides a form of memory for the differential gene expression pattern to maintain cell lineage, position-effect variegation, dosage compensation, and maintenance of chromatin structures such as telomeres and centromeres. 背景情况:

  • 三虫 (Trypanosoma cruzi,Trypanosoma brucei,Leishmania major) 引起了人类和动物的重大疾病.
  • 这些寄生虫具有复杂的生命周期和独特的基因表达机制,包括多晶体转录和转接.
  • 多复制基因对于TriTryp宿主入侵和免疫逃避至关重要.

研究的目的:

  • 在TriTryps中预测跨拼接受体位点 (TAS).
  • 为了研究围绕TASs的染色质组织.
  • 探索确保跨拼接忠实性的潜在机制.

主要方法:

  • 对TASs的生物信息预测.
  • 染色素消化和分析 (MNase敏感性).
  • 单复制基因和多复制基因之间的比较色素结构分析.

主要成果:

  • 在TriTryps中具有一致的染色体组织,在TASs中具有轻微的核细胞体枯竭.
  • 在T. brucei.中识别了一种MNase-敏感复合体,含有组织蛋白,保护TASs.
  • 在T. cruzi单复制基因与多复制基因的TAS中差异化染色质结构.

结论:

  • 染色体结构在调节TriTryps中转链接方面发挥着作用.
  • 一个含 histone 的复合体可能会保护 TAS,确保跨拼接的准确性.
  • 不同的染色质组织可能代表了调节试类动物基因表达忠实性的新机制.
